A Guide to Sourcing a Family-Friendly Resort

Planning a holiday for a young family is much easier if you book at a suitable resort that is family oriented, as they would have all the amenities and resources to ensure a comfortable experience. Here are just a few of the facilities to look for when searching for the ideal family resort accommodation.

  • Water Sports – Aside from having a kiddies swimming pool next to the adult one, there should be a few slides and an area where the children can safely play in the sand. All young children are drawn to the pool and with a fair-sized resort, your kids will have a great time poolside.
  • Child Care Services – Babysitting services should be available at all times, so you and your partner can enjoy romantic candlelit dinners after a busy day with the children, and with your smartphone number, the carer can call you if the need arises.

Make sure to pack any medication you or your family might be taking, plus a small bag with extra baby wipes and clean clothes for the children.
  • Read Guest Reviews – TripAdvisor is a great organisation that gives you unbiased reviews that will help you to plan the perfect holiday. Guests would leave comments on the resort website, so do check these, especially if they are recent.
  • Recommendations – You no doubt have friends who have young families, and by asking about their previous holiday experiences, you might find the perfect resort. A recommendation from someone you know is more valuable that any advertising, as it tells you about every aspect, particularly the service.
